estructura de datos

Páginas: 14 (3322 palabras) Publicado: 30 de junio de 2013























INDICE
Pág.

Introducción..………………………………………………………………………... 3
Desarrollo Teórico……………………………………………………………...……. 4
DesarrolloPractico…………………………………………………………………… 18
Conclusión…………………………………………………………………………… 20
Bibliografía…………………………………………………………………………... 21
Anexos……………………………………………………………………………… 22
















Introducción
Una base de datos es una colección de información ordenada e interrelacionada que es de importancia para una empresa .La creación de una base de datos debe ser realizada cuidadosamente procurando cumplir con una serie de objetivos que sedetallan a continuación: Permitir un fácil acceso a la información. El sistema debe ser facilitador de alto rendimiento la velocidad es un factor esencial así como la consistencia de los datos. Evitar redundancia de la información. La información almacenada ocupará irremediablemente un espacio en memoria por lo cual es de vital importancia eliminar la posibilidad de almacenar datos repetidos yaque adicionalmente podrían llevarnos a inconsistencias en la información.

















Desarrollo del tema teórico
1. Estructura de datos:
En programación, una estructura de datos es una forma de organizar un conjunto de datos elementales con el objetivo de facilitar su manipulación. Un dato elemental es la mínima información que se tiene en un sistema.
Una estructura dedatos define la organización e interrelación de estos y un conjunto de operaciones que se pueden realizar sobre ellos. Las operaciones básicas son:
Alta, adicionar un nuevo valor a la estructura.
Baja, borrar un valor de la estructura.
Búsqueda, encontrar un determinado valor en la estructura para realizar una operación con este valor, en forma secuencial o binario (siempre y cuando los datosestén ordenados).
Otras operaciones que se pueden realizar son:
Ordenamiento, de los elementos pertenecientes a la estructura.
Apareo, dadas dos estructuras originar una nueva ordenada y que contenga a las apareadas.
Cada estructura ofrece ventajas y desventajas en relación a la simplicidad y eficiencia para la realización de cada operación. De esta forma, la elección de la estructura de datosapropiada para cada problema depende de factores como la frecuencia y el orden en que se realiza cada operación sobre los datos.
Estructura de un programa en Turbo Pascal: Al igual que una carta comercial o un trabajo escolar escrito deben seguir siempre un modelo de escritura; así también, un programa escrito en Turbo Pascal deberá seguir una misma estructura básica de escritura de lasinstrucciones que lo conforman. En el mismo orden de la lista a continuación, se escriben las partes que conforman la estructura de un programa en Turbo Pascal:
1. Cabecera del programa
2. Sección de Unidades o Librerías
3. Sección de Declaraciones
1. Declaración de Etiquetas
2. Declaración de Constantes
3. Declaración de Tipos definidos por Usuario
4. Declaración de Variables
5. Declaración deProcedimientos y Funciones
4. Cuerpo del programa Principal
Cabecera del programa
En la cabecera del programa se especifica el nombre y los parámetros del programa, esta es solamente informativa y no tiene ninguna utilidad para programa en sí. Esta sección corresponde a la primera línea del programa, la cual está encabezada por la palabra reservada PROGRAM, seguida de un nombre cualquiera para elprograma definido por el usuario. La sintaxis para esta sección es la siguiente:
PROGRAM Nombre Programa;
El primer carácter para el nombre debe ser obligatoriamente una letra, y los caracteres siguientes a la primera letra; pueden letras, números, o el carácter guión bajo [_], no se permiten usar espacios en blanco, ni tampoco se pueden usar las palabra...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Estructura de Datos
  • Estructura De Datos
  • Estructura de datos
  • Estructura de datos
  • Estructura de datos
  • Estructuras de datos
  • Estructura de Datos
  • estructura de datos

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S